1. Prayer for Strength in Hard Times
Heavenly Father, I come before You seeking strength in my trials. When I feel weak, lift me up with Your unwavering power. Let Your Spirit guide me through challenges, granting me courage and resilience. Help me to trust Your timing and Your plan, even when life feels overwhelming. May Your presence be my anchor, and may I lean on You daily for strength, knowing that with You, nothing is impossible. Thank You for being my refuge and my rock, and for giving me the power to endure every storm. Amen.
2. Prayer for Inner Peace
Lord, I ask for Your peace to fill my heart and mind. Calm my anxious thoughts and replace fear with faith. Help me to surrender my worries, trusting that You are in control. Guide me in finding serenity in Your Word and in Your promises. May Your Spirit dwell within me, offering comfort in moments of uncertainty. Teach me to embrace patience, love, and understanding, and help me reflect Your peace to those around me. I commit my mind, body, and soul to Your care. Amen.
3. Prayer for Guidance
Father God, I seek Your guidance in every step I take. Illuminate my path, showing me the way that aligns with Your will.
Help me discern the right choices and give me the wisdom to act with integrity and faith. In moments of confusion, remind me to pause and listen to Your voice.
Lead me through decisions both great and small, and strengthen my trust in Your divine direction. May Your light shine in my life and guide me closer to You every day. Amen.
4. Prayer for Healing
Gracious Lord, I ask for Your healing touch in my life. Restore my body, mind, and spirit with Your divine power.
Ease my pain and grant me patience during recovery. Surround me with Your love and let Your presence bring comfort to my heart.
Heal the wounds I carry, both seen and unseen, and renew my spirit with hope and faith. Help me trust in Your timing and embrace Your grace in every stage of healing. Amen.

FAQs:
1. What are the different types of prayers in the Bible?
The Bible shows various prayers including prayers of thanksgiving, intercession, confession, guidance, and healing. Each type serves a unique purpose in spiritual life.
2. How often should I pray?
Prayer can be done daily or anytime you feel the need to connect with God. Consistency strengthens faith and brings peace.
3. Can short prayers be powerful?
Yes! Short prayers are often simple but deeply impactful. It’s the sincerity of the heart that makes them powerful.
4. How do I pray for strength during difficult times?
Focus on God’s promises, ask for His guidance, and trust Him. Use specific prayers for strength in hard times to find courage.
5. Can prayer help with spiritual growth?
Absolutely. Spiritual prayers deepen your connection with God, help cultivate virtues, and guide you in living a life aligned with His will.
